"overnet" meaning in English

See overnet in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Verb

Forms: overnets [present, singular, third-person], overnetting [participle, present], overnetted [participle, past], overnetted [past]
Etymology: From over- + net. Etymology templates: {{prefix|en|over|net}} over- + net Head templates: {{en-verb|++}} overnet (third-person singular simple present overnets, present participle overnetting, simple past and past participle overnetted)
  1. (transitive) To cover with a net or netting. Tags: transitive
    Sense id: en-overnet-en-verb-8o5tk9uq
  2. To fish too much using nets.
